Luke 11:4
Good News Translation
Forgive us our sins, for we forgive everyone who does us wrong. And do not bring us to hard testing.'"

New Revised Standard Version
And forgive us our sins, for we ourselves forgive everyone indebted to us. And do not bring us to the time of trial.”

Contemporary English Version
Forgive our sins, as we forgive everyone who has done wrong to us. And keep us from being tempted.'"

New American Bible
and forgive us our sins for we ourselves forgive everyone in debt to us, and do not subject us to the final test.”

Douay-Rheims Bible
And forgive us our sins, for we also forgive every one that is indebted to us. And lead us not into temptation.
